To enter decimals in the sat list use the program I linked to above Syntext Serna..it's free. Open the program choose open and brows to your sat.xml file, choose default view when prompted. The Sat list and Transponder list will appear on the left..you can brows down to what values you would like to change on a particular sat. For example sat ID #44 on my list would be Anik F1R 107.3

Now you will see default view at the top..Use the drop down to change to Edit Attributes..

From here you can change the values, use -1073 for 107.3 this will give you the decimal

Click save, then document and click save as--point to your sat.xml file and it will ask to overwrite..choose yes. Now you can load to the Alien using the data transformer menu.. Once loaded (this only takes a few seconds) go to installation and you will see Anik F1R has now been change to 107.3
